1. Introduction to Rutin

Rutin is a bioactive compound that has been the focus of extensive research in recent years. It is a flavonoid glycoside, which is widely distributed in various plants. Structurally, it consists of Quercetin and a disaccharide Rutinose. This unique structure endows Rutin with a variety of biological activities.

2. Rutin in the Medical Industry

2.1 Anti - platelet Aggregation

One of the most significant pharmacological activities of Rutin in medicine is its ability to anti - platelet aggregation. Platelets play a crucial role in blood clotting. However, excessive platelet aggregation can lead to the formation of thrombi, which are associated with various cardiovascular diseases such as myocardial infarction and stroke. Rutin inhibits platelet aggregation by interfering with the signaling pathways involved in platelet activation. This helps to maintain normal blood flow and reduces the risk of thrombotic events.

2.2 Vasoprotective Functions

Rutin also exhibits vasoprotective functions. It helps to maintain the integrity of blood vessels. It can strengthen the walls of blood vessels by promoting the synthesis of collagen and elastin, which are important components of the vascular extracellular matrix. Additionally, Rutin has antioxidant properties that protect blood vessels from oxidative damage caused by free radicals. Oxidative stress can damage the endothelial cells lining the blood vessels, leading to endothelial dysfunction, which is an early event in the development of cardiovascular diseases. By reducing oxidative stress, Rutin helps to preserve the normal function of blood vessels.

2.3 Other Potential Medical Benefits

- Anti - inflammatory Effects: Rutin has been shown to possess anti - inflammatory properties. It can modulate the immune response and reduce the production of inflammatory mediators such as cytokines and prostaglandins. This makes it potentially useful in the treatment of inflammatory diseases such as arthritis. - Anticancer Activity: Some studies have suggested that Rutin may have anticancer activity. It may act by inducing apoptosis (programmed cell death) in cancer cells, inhibiting tumor cell proliferation, and suppressing angiogenesis (the formation of new blood vessels that supply nutrients to tumors). However, more research is needed to fully understand its role in cancer treatment.

3. Rutin in the Agricultural Industry

3.1 Natural Pesticides

In the agricultural industry, Rutin - rich plant extracts can be used as natural pesticides. These extracts have insecticidal and pesticidal properties. They can repel or kill pests such as insects and mites, without leaving harmful residues on crops as many synthetic pesticides do. For example, some plants that are rich in Rutin, when their extracts are applied to crops, can protect the plants from pest infestations. This is an environmentally friendly alternative to synthetic pesticides, which are often associated with environmental pollution and potential harm to human health.

3.2 Growth Regulators

Rutin can also function as a growth regulator in plants. It can influence plant growth and development in several ways. It may promote root growth by stimulating cell division and elongation in the root meristem. It can also enhance shoot growth by regulating the synthesis and distribution of plant hormones such as auxins. Moreover, Rutin - rich plant extracts can improve plant resistance to environmental stresses such as drought, salinity, and cold. This is because Rutin can enhance the antioxidant defense system in plants, protecting them from oxidative damage caused by stress factors.

4. Rutin in the Nutraceutical Market

4.1 Health - Promoting Effects on the Human Body

In the nutraceutical market, Rutin is a popular ingredient due to its potential health - promoting effects on the human body. One of the main benefits is its ability to improve blood circulation. By reducing platelet aggregation and improving the function of blood vessels, Rutin helps to ensure proper blood flow throughout the body. This can have a positive impact on various organs and tissues, including the heart, brain, and extremities.

4.2 Reducing Oxidative Stress

Another important aspect of Rutin's role in nutraceuticals is its ability to reduce oxidative stress. The human body is constantly exposed to free radicals, which are generated during normal metabolic processes as well as from environmental factors such as pollution and radiation. Free radicals can cause damage to cells, proteins, and DNA, leading to various diseases and aging. Rutin, with its antioxidant properties, can scavenge free radicals and protect the body from oxidative damage.
